It is important to remember that PowerPoint slideshow presentations are usually intended to enhance a presenter's speech or event, not really be the main focus. While it might be desirable to create a dynamic slideshow that crackles with color, sound, and movement, you should keep in mind your main goal of why you're having the slideshow in the first place, and the demographics of your audience as well. For example, a presentation meant for a classroom full of eight-year-olds should be very different from a presentation intended for a conference room full of bank employees.
